Course Spotlights Marriage & Family
There's More to Do After You Say "I Do"
Whether youre a newlywed, ready to start a family or want a stimulating course that meets degree and transfer requirements, you can learn more about the social influences that affect American expressions of intimate lifestyles related to relationships, marriage and family systems by enrolling in the four-unit SOC 40: Aspects of Marriage & Family course.
By using methods of social research, you will examine theoretical and empirical studies conducted by family sociologists. The course meets the requirement for the Foothill associate degree as well as the IGETC and CSU general education breadth requirements.

Go Behind the Scenes of American Cinema
Discover the inner workings of Hollywoods cinema star and studio systems by enrolling in the four-unit Film/TV 3: American Cinema course. In addition to viewing and discussing the most significant films in the history of these movies, youll examine the historic, economic and cultural background that forms the American cinema. The class meets Thursdays, from 6 to 9:40 p.m.
